Comparison of Species Assemblages Using Date Depth and Mixture Model

Abstract

Comparing species assemblages at different times and locations provides useful

information regarding the ecosystem. Due to the unique structure

of abundance data often collected in species assemblage, appropriate

statistical tests are in need. In this thesis, we propose two types of tests,

one is data depth based nonparametric test, the other is a zero-inflated Poisson mixture model based test. These two types of tests are developed for different testing objectives and under different assumptions. We use simulation to demonstrate that their performance is better than that of the existing tests. We also discuss the differences of these two tests.
